Interface SparqlQueryConnectionTmp

All Superinterfaces:
AutoCloseable, org.apache.jena.rdfconnection.SparqlQueryConnection, org.apache.jena.sparql.core.Transactional, TransactionalWrapper
All Known Implementing Classes:
SparqlQueryConnectionJsa, SparqlQueryConnectionJsaBase, SparqlQueryConnectionWithExecFails, SparqlQueryConnectionWithExecTransform, SparqlQueryConnectionWithReconnect

public interface SparqlQueryConnectionTmp extends TransactionalWrapper, org.apache.jena.rdfconnection.SparqlQueryConnection
Temporary interface; DO NOT reference it directly. It will be removed once Jena moves these defaults to their own interface
Author:
raven
  • Nested Class Summary

    Nested classes/interfaces inherited from interface org.apache.jena.sparql.core.Transactional

    org.apache.jena.sparql.core.Transactional.Promote
  • Method Summary

    Modifier and Type
    Method
    Description
    default org.apache.jena.query.QueryExecutionBuilder
     
    default org.apache.jena.query.Query
    parse(String query)
     
    default org.apache.jena.query.QueryExecution
    query(String queryString)
    Setup a SPARQL query execution.
    org.apache.jena.query.QueryExecution
    query(org.apache.jena.query.Query query)
    Setup a SPARQL query execution.
    default boolean
    Execute a ASK query and return a boolean
    default boolean
    queryAsk(org.apache.jena.query.Query query)
    Execute a ASK query and return a boolean
    default org.apache.jena.rdf.model.Model
    Execute a CONSTRUCT query and return as a Model
    default org.apache.jena.rdf.model.Model
    queryConstruct(org.apache.jena.query.Query query)
    Execute a CONSTRUCT query and return as a Model
    default org.apache.jena.rdf.model.Model
    Execute a DESCRIBE query and return as a Model
    default org.apache.jena.rdf.model.Model
    queryDescribe(org.apache.jena.query.Query query)
    Execute a DESCRIBE query and return as a Model
    default void
    queryResultSet(String query, Consumer<org.apache.jena.query.ResultSet> resultSetAction)
    Execute a SELECT query and process the ResultSet with the handler code.
    default void
    queryResultSet(org.apache.jena.query.Query query, Consumer<org.apache.jena.query.ResultSet> resultSetAction)
    Execute a SELECT query and process the ResultSet with the handler code.
    default void
    querySelect(String query, Consumer<org.apache.jena.query.QuerySolution> rowAction)
    Execute a SELECT query and process the rows of the results with the handler code.
    default void
    querySelect(org.apache.jena.query.Query query, Consumer<org.apache.jena.query.QuerySolution> rowAction)
    Execute a SELECT query and process the rows of the results with the handler code.

    Methods inherited from interface org.apache.jena.rdfconnection.SparqlQueryConnection

    close

    Methods inherited from interface org.apache.jena.sparql.core.Transactional

    begin, calc, calculate, calculateRead, calculateWrite, exec, execute, executeRead, executeWrite, promote

    Methods inherited from interface org.aksw.jenax.dataaccess.sparql.common.TransactionalWrapper

    abort, begin, begin, commit, end, getDelegate, getTransactionalDelegate, isInTransaction, promote, transactionMode, transactionType
  • Method Details

    • parse

      default org.apache.jena.query.Query parse(String query)
    • queryResultSet

      default void queryResultSet(String query, Consumer<org.apache.jena.query.ResultSet> resultSetAction)
      Execute a SELECT query and process the ResultSet with the handler code.
      Specified by:
      queryResultSet in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      query -
      resultSetAction -
    • queryResultSet

      default void queryResultSet(org.apache.jena.query.Query query, Consumer<org.apache.jena.query.ResultSet> resultSetAction)
      Execute a SELECT query and process the ResultSet with the handler code.
      Specified by:
      queryResultSet in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      query -
      resultSetAction -
    • querySelect

      default void querySelect(String query, Consumer<org.apache.jena.query.QuerySolution> rowAction)
      Execute a SELECT query and process the rows of the results with the handler code.
      Specified by:
      querySelect in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      query -
      rowAction -
    • querySelect

      default void querySelect(org.apache.jena.query.Query query, Consumer<org.apache.jena.query.QuerySolution> rowAction)
      Execute a SELECT query and process the rows of the results with the handler code.
      Specified by:
      querySelect in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      query -
      rowAction -
    • queryConstruct

      default org.apache.jena.rdf.model.Model queryConstruct(String query)
      Execute a CONSTRUCT query and return as a Model
      Specified by:
      queryConstruct in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• queryConstruct

      default org.apache.jena.rdf.model.Model queryConstruct(org.apache.jena.query.Query query)
      Execute a CONSTRUCT query and return as a Model
      Specified by:
      queryConstruct in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• queryDescribe

      default org.apache.jena.rdf.model.Model queryDescribe(String query)
      Execute a DESCRIBE query and return as a Model
      Specified by:
      queryDescribe in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• queryDescribe

      default org.apache.jena.rdf.model.Model queryDescribe(org.apache.jena.query.Query query)
      Execute a DESCRIBE query and return as a Model
      Specified by:
      queryDescribe in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• queryAsk

      default boolean queryAsk(String query)
      Execute a ASK query and return a boolean
      Specified by:
      queryAsk in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• queryAsk

      default boolean queryAsk(org.apache.jena.query.Query query)
      Execute a ASK query and return a boolean
      Specified by:
      queryAsk in interface org.apache.jena.rdfconnection.SparqlQueryConnection
    • query

      org.apache.jena.query.QueryExecution query(org.apache.jena.query.Query query)
      Setup a SPARQL query execution. See also querySelect(Query, Consumer), queryConstruct(Query), queryDescribe(Query), queryAsk(Query) for ways to execute queries for of a specific form.
      Specified by:
      query in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      query -
      Returns:
      QueryExecution
    • query

      default org.apache.jena.query.QueryExecution query(String queryString)
      Setup a SPARQL query execution. See also querySelect(String, Consumer), queryConstruct(String), queryDescribe(String), queryAsk(String) for ways to execute queries for of a specific form.
      Specified by:
      query in interface org.apache.jena.rdfconnection.SparqlQueryConnection
      Parameters:
      queryString -
      Returns:
      QueryExecution
    • newQuery

      default org.apache.jena.query.QueryExecutionBuilder newQuery()
      Specified by:
      newQuery in interface org.apache.jena.rdfconnection.SparqlQueryConnection